This page tracks congressional stock trading activity in Ford Motor Company (F) in the Consumer Cyclical sector. Disclosed Capitol has indexed 261 disclosed congressional trades involving F. Every trade is sourced from official STOCK Act financial disclosure filings — the same primary records the Senate and House are required to publish. The full trade list with politician names, transaction types, amount ranges, and disclosure dates is below, alongside cross-references to any related lobbying activity, federal contracts, and committee assignments.
As of July 2026 — Disclosed Capitol has tracked 261 disclosed congressional trades in Ford Motor Company (F) — 108:67 sell-heavy ratio — led by Ro Khanna (D).

Across the 261 disclosed congressional trades in Ford Motor Company (F), members of Congress have reported 67 buys and 108 sells. The average 30-day alpha vs. the S&P 500 is -0.07%.
As of August 2026, Ford Motor Company has 27,599 federal contract award records on file from USAspending.gov — most recently $52K from the General Services Administration on 2026-08-03.

For fiscal year 2025, Ford Motor Company reported revenue of $187.27B and net income of -$8.18B, per SEC filings.
Most recent reported quarter: Q1 FY2026 — revenue $43.25B, net income $2.55B.
